Toubleshooting (continuted)
If the bike runs, but poorly, put the stock ignition back on the bike. If this fixes the problem, reinstall the Dyna
ignition. If you are using non stock plug wires, plug cap, ignition coil, spark plug, or stator, replace them with OEM
units. Then follow the procedures in the calibration section to set the Dyna ignition up to work with your bike. If
calibration doesn't fix the problem, the ignition should be returned for testing. If the problem persists when using the
stock ignition then the problem is external to the Dyna ignition. Follow the test procedures outlined in your bike
owners manual to pinpoint the problem.

WARNING:

Installation of a grounded tether kill switch to the ignition coil signal

will damage the CDI and void the warranty.


Magneto-CDI (Banshee/TRX250R/400EX/450R/etc.): Use a normally open tether kill switch
connected in parallel with the stock kill switch input to the ignition. When the tether is removed, it
should ground the input to the ignition.
